电脑乌龟编程入门指南318


什么是电脑乌龟编程?

电脑乌龟编程是一种面向少儿的编程语言,它以可爱的乌龟形象为基础,用图形化的方式展示编程概念。学习者通过控制乌龟的移动、绘制图形和与其他乌龟交互,理解编程的基本原理。

为什么学习电脑乌龟编程?

电脑乌龟编程非常适合儿童学习编程,因为它具有一些独特的优势:* 视觉直观:乌龟在屏幕上移动,绘制图形,使编程过程变得生动有趣。
* 循序渐进:课程从基础指令开始,逐步增加复杂性,让初学者 dễ dàng上手。
* 培养逻辑思维:解编程问题需要分析、推理和决策能力,有助于培养孩子的逻辑思维能力。
* 提高解决问题能力:编程过程经常需要解决问题,这可以锻炼孩子的解决问题能力。
* 增强协作能力:电脑乌龟编程支持多人协作,鼓励孩子分享想法并共同创作。

电脑乌龟编程基础

电脑乌龟编程的基本指令包括:* 设置绘制颜色:color
* 向前移动:fd
* 向后移动:bk
* 向左转:lt
* 向右转:rt
* 提笔:pu
* 落笔:pd

示例程序:正方形和三角形

使用这些基本指令,可以创建简单的图形:正方形:
```
color red
fd 100
lt 90
fd 100
lt 90
fd 100
lt 90
fd 100
lt 90
```
三角形:
```
color blue
fd 100
rt 120
fd 100
rt 120
fd 100
rt 120
```

使用变量和循环

电脑乌龟编程还支持变量和循环,这可以使代码更简洁、更有效率。变量:
```
make "side" 100
color red
repeat 4 [
fd :side
lt 90
]
```
循环:
```
repeat 3 [
fd 100
rt 120
]
```

高级概念

随着学习的深入,可以接触到更高级的概念,例如:* 函数:可以创建自己的函数来重复使用代码。
* 条件语句:可以根据条件执行不同的代码。
* 列表和数组:可以存储和操作数据集合。
* 传感器:可以与外部设备(例如摄像头)交互。

电脑乌龟编程学习资源

有许多资源可以帮助你学习电脑乌龟编程:* :官方网站,提供教程和在线编辑器。
* :基于Blockly的图形化编程界面。
* :提供基于游戏的互动教程。
* :提供基于电脑乌龟编程的互动课程。

结语

电脑乌龟编程是一种有趣且有效的学习编程的方式,非常适合儿童。通过控制可爱的乌龟,学习者可以了解编程的基本原理,培养逻辑思维和解决问题能力。随着学习的深入,可以接触到更高级的概念,为未来的计算机科学学习奠定基础。

2025-02-06


上一篇:电脑编程学姐的宝藏经验分享

下一篇:中文编程写作:指南与技巧